Sell-by date

sell-by date
~ n BrE 1 the date stamped on a food product, after which it should not be sold; expiration date AmE 2 be past its sell-by date informal if an idea, method, system etc is past its sell-by date it has become no longer useful or interesting

  (sell-by dates) 1. The sell-by date on a food container is the date by which the food should be sold or eaten before it starts to decay. (BRIT; in AM, use expiration date) ...a piece of cheese four weeks past its sell-by date. N-COUNT 2. If you say that someone or something is past their sell-by date, you mean they are no longer effective, interesting, or useful. (BRIT) As a sportsman, he is long past his sell-by date.
